Triassic herbivore Dinodontosaurus discovered in Tanzania reshapes dinosaur timeline

Scientists have identified a new species of giant, tusked herbivore, Dinodontosaurus isiyavamanda, from 240-million-year-old rocks in Tanzania, linking the region to South American fossils and prompting a rethink of early dinosaur ages.

A previously unknown Triassic herbivore, Dinodontosaurus isiyavamanda, has been described from fossils uncovered in Tanzania in the 1960s and housed at the Natural History Museum, London. Curator Mike Day highlighted that the specimen, now recognized as a large, tusked dicynodont, lived around 240 million years ago and likely moved in herds, using its turtle-like beak and formidable tusks for feeding and defense. Led by researchers from the University of Bristol, the study confirms the species’ presence in both Tanzania and South America, linking the two regions’ geological sequences.

Radiometric dating suggests the Tanzanian rocks are up to 10 million years younger than comparable South African layers, meaning they no longer represent the oldest possible dinosaur fossils. The discovery therefore refines the timeline for dinosaur origins and will guide future biomechanical and ecological investigations of Triassic dicynodonts.

Why it matters

The find revises the age of rocks once thought to hold the earliest dinosaurs, altering our understanding of dinosaur evolution.
